IOM Chamber partners with North East England Chamber to enhance trade support & certification services | July 2023


13 July 2023


The Isle of Man Chamber of Commerce has announced a new partnership with the North East England Chamber of Commerce to provide Island businesses with trade support and certification services.

This collaboration, says the IOM Chamber, aims to ‘provide its members with comprehensive solutions and expert advice to help them negotiate the evolving landscape of international trade’.

IOM Chamber CEO, Rebecca George, said: “We are thrilled about our partnership with North East England Chamber. Over the past four years we have witnessed a gradual decline in demand for export documents generally, and Certificates of Origin specifically. The British Chambers of Commerce has confirmed a global downturn in the demand for export documents. For many years we have offered a Certificates of Origin service to our members, but it’s no longer practical or cost-effective do this on our own – that’s why we have decided to partner with North East England so that we can continue to offer this service to our members who need it. This partnership ensures our members have access to the expertise and resources necessary to thrive in the international trade arena.”

John McCabe, Chief Executive at North East England Chamber of Commerce, said: “As the leading North East organisation for international trade, we are proud to offer Isle of Man Chamber members access to our multi-disciplinary suite of international services, knowledge and expertise. We offer a comprehensive range of trade services, including export documents, international trade consultancy and BCC-accredited training courses. We have also recently introduced a service for those outside of the Chamber network, which further enhances the offer to Isle of Man businesses. Collaboration is key to business success and we are proud to work with our overseas colleagues to secure a brighter, stronger and united future for Chamber members.”
